阿里DNS优化是提升互联网访问速度、稳定性和安全性的关键举措,通过技术手段解决传统DNS解析中的延迟、丢包、攻击等问题,为企业和个人用户提供更优质的域名解析服务,以下从技术原理、优化策略、应用场景及实际效果等方面展开详细分析。
阿里DNS优化的核心目标
DNS(域名系统)作为互联网的“电话簿”,其性能直接影响用户访问体验,阿里DNS优化主要围绕三大目标展开:降低解析延迟、提升解析成功率和增强安全防护能力,传统DNS解析可能因递归查询路径长、节点分布不均、缓存机制不合理等问题导致响应缓慢,而阿里通过全球分布式节点、智能调度算法和边缘计算技术,实现了毫秒级解析响应,保障全球用户访问的流畅性。
关键技术优化手段
全球分布式节点架构
阿里DNS在全球部署超过2800个加速节点,覆盖50+国家地区,通过Anycast技术将用户请求路由至最近的DNS服务器,减少物理距离带来的延迟,中国用户请求会优先调度至国内节点,海外用户则接入就近节点,平均解析延迟降低至10ms以内。
智能解析与调度算法
采用多维度调度策略,结合实时网络质量数据(如丢包率、延迟)、用户地理位置、负载均衡状态等信息,动态选择最优解析路径,当检测到某条网络链路拥堵时,系统会自动切换至备用线路,确保解析请求的高可用性,通过HTTPDNS技术将DNS查询迁移至HTTPS协议,避免传统UDP协议易被劫持的问题,提升安全性。
缓存机制优化
通过多级缓存策略(本地缓存、节点缓存、区域缓存)减少重复查询,本地缓存可设置TTL(生存时间)动态调整,热点域名(如电商大促期间)延长缓存时间,冷门域名则缩短缓存以避免信息过期,通过预解析技术,提前预测用户可能的访问需求,在用户发起请求前完成解析,进一步缩短等待时间。
安全防护体系
针对DNS劫持、DDoS攻击等威胁,阿里DNS集成多层防护机制:
- 流量清洗:通过分布式清洗中心过滤恶意流量,保障合法解析请求的畅通;
- 加密传输:支持DNS-over-TLS(DoT)和DNS-over-HTTPS(DoH),防止查询内容被窃听或篡改;
- 行为分析:基于机器学习识别异常解析模式(如短时间内大量请求同一域名),自动触发防护策略。
协议与性能升级
全面支持DNSSEC(域名系统安全扩展)技术,通过数字签名验证域名数据的真实性和完整性,防止DNS欺骗,优化UDP协议栈处理能力,在高并发场景下(如秒杀活动)确保每秒千万级解析请求的稳定处理。
典型应用场景与效果
- 企业业务加速:某跨国企业通过阿里DNS全球调度,海外用户访问中国官网的延迟降低40%,业务转化率提升15%;
- 移动端优化:集成HTTPDNS后,移动App因DNS劫持导致的失败率从5%降至0.1%,用户投诉量减少60%;
- 大促保障:双11期间,阿里DNS承接峰值超2亿QPS(每秒查询次数),解析成功率99.99%,保障电商平台流畅访问。
相关问答FAQs
Q1:阿里DNS与传统DNS服务商的主要区别是什么?
A1:阿里DNS的核心优势在于全球分布式节点覆盖、智能调度算法和一体化安全防护,传统服务商节点较少,调度依赖静态路由,而阿里通过Anycast和实时网络数据分析实现动态优化;阿里DNS集成DDoS防护、加密传输等安全功能,提供从解析到访问的全链路保障,更适合对性能和安全要求高的企业级场景。
Q2:如何验证阿里DNS优化后的实际效果?
A2:可通过以下方式评估:
- 延迟测试:使用
dig
或ping
命令对比解析同一域名时阿里DNS与公共DNS的响应时间; - 可用性监控:通过阿里云云监控服务设置解析成功率告警,统计24小时内成功解析比例;
- 业务指标:对于网站或App,分析接入阿里DNS后的页面加载速度、用户跳出率等数据变化,阿里云提供DNS性能测试工具,可生成详细的延迟分布、节点调度等报告。